A PETITION has been launched to save a town's tip.

Residents and councillors have hit back at the rumoured proposals to shut Dovercourt Recycling Centre, which they say is a popular and vital facility for the town.

Maps leaked to the Standard last week revealed proposals to close a number of Recycling Centres in Essex to save cash.

But drivers trying to use the West End Lane site, which would be merged with Lawford 13 miles away in the plans, over the bank holiday weekend said they were stuck in long queues of more than half an hour, proving its necessity for residents.

Harwich Labour councillors have set up a petition calling for the Dovercourt Tip to be protected.

Maria Fowler, labour councillor for Harwich West Central, where the tip is based, said: "In my opinion it's absolute madness.

"Flytipping will be everywhere, there is already flytipping outside the tip when it's closed."
